Matlab代码“awgn.m”用于在整个过程中添加AWGN。通过“readsample.m”从Verilog仿真中读取1000万个样本,并与正态分布进行比较。通过“rom_gen.m”从浮点到硬件生成二进制系数。测试平台“awgntb.v”生成一千万个噪声样本,并将所有样本输出到“samples.txt”以供分析。另一个测试平台“awgntb_err.v”生成100000个样本,并将位错误与Matlab样本进行比较。